A brokerage account lets you buy a variety of investment assets—like mutual funds, stocks, ETFs, bonds and more. A brokerage account is generally less restrictive than an IRA or retirement account; there is no contribution limit and you can withdraw your money at any time for any reason.

Freight Broker Bond – BMC-84 bond, is required by FMCSA ( Federal Motor Carrier safety Administration) for all companies providing brokerage or freight forwarding services. As of October 1, 2013 FMCSA increased the minimum financial responsibility to $75,000 freight broker bond, also know as a MBC-84. Formerly known as the Interstate Commerce ...

Putting …When a brokerage firm sells you a bond in a principal capacity, it may increase or mark up the price you pay over the price the firm paid to acquire the bond. Similarly, if you sell a bond, the firm may offer you a price that includes a markdown from the price at which it believes it can sell the bond. The markup or markdown is the brokerage ...
